Gram panchayat finances, 2024–25

XV Finance Commission grant for Pehariya panchayat, Silwani zila parishad. These are the panchayat's own accounts, not this village's: where a panchayat holds several villages, the money covers all of them, and where a village spans several panchayats only this one's return appears.

Opening balance
₹11.38 lakh
Received from state (auto-transfer)
₹3.35 lakh
Received directly
Spent
₹9.36 lakh
Unspent at year end
₹5.38 lakh
Untied (basic grant)
opened ₹1.31 lakh · received ₹1.34 lakh · spent ₹1.48 lakh · left ₹1.17 lakh
Tied (earmarked)
opened ₹10.07 lakh · received ₹2.01 lakh · spent ₹7.87 lakh · left ₹4.21 lakh

Source: eGramSwaraj, as reported by the panchayat. Untied and tied together make up the totals above.
